Senior Software Platform Engineer

2 weeks ago


Australia beBeeEngineer Full time $180,000 - $240,000

Job Overview

The role is a fast-paced, problem-solving position that involves working across the full Linux stack from kernel through GUI to optimize Ubuntu for the latest silicon.

You will design and implement the best integration of the Ubuntu platform on the latest IoT and server-class hardware platforms and software stacks. You will work with partners to deliver a delightful, optimized experience on their platforms.

As a senior engineer, you will participate as technical lead on complex customer engagements involving complete system architectures from cloud to edge. You will help our customers integrate their applications, build device OS images, and optimize apps with Ubuntu Core, Desktop, and Server.

You will work with advanced operating systems and application technologies available in the enterprise world. Joining our organization, you will partner with talented individuals from around the globe and work with exciting new technologies in a rapidly growing company with a unique vision.

Responsibilities

  • Design and implement the best integration of the Ubuntu platform on the latest IoT and server-class hardware platforms and software stacks
  • Work with partners to deliver a delightful, optimized experience on their platforms
  • Participate as technical lead on complex customer engagements involving complete system architectures from cloud to edge
  • Help our customers integrate their applications, build device OS images, and optimize apps with Ubuntu Core, Desktop, and Server
  • Work with advanced operating systems and application technologies available in the enterprise world

Requirements

  • Lovethe technology and working with brilliant people
  • Bachelor's degree in Computer Science, STEM, or similar
  • Experience with Linux packaging (Debian, RPM, Yocto)
  • Experience working with open source communities and licenses
  • Experience working with C and C++
  • Ability to work in a globally distributed team through self-discipline and self-motivation

Additional Skills That You Might Also Bring

  • Experience with graphics stacks
  • Good understanding of networking - TCP/IP, DHCP, HTTP/REST
  • Basic understanding of security best practices in IoT or server environments
  • Good communication skills, ideally public speaking experience
  • IoT/embedded experience – from board and SoC, BMCs, bootloaders, and firmware to OS, through apps and services
  • Some experience with Docker/OCI containers/K8s

About Us

Our organization is a pioneering tech firm at the forefront of the global move to open source. As the publishers of Ubuntu, one of the most important open source projects and the platform for AI, IoT, and the cloud, we are changing the world daily. We recruit on a global basis and set a high standard for people joining the organization. Excellence is expected - to succeed, we need to be the best at what we do.

Our organization has been remote-first since its inception in 2004. Work with us offers a step into the future, challenging you to think differently, work smarter, learn new skills, and raise your game. Our organization provides a unique window into the world of 21st-century digital business.

Our organization is an equal opportunity employer. We proudly foster a workplace free from discrimination. Diversity of experience, perspectives, and background creates a better work environment and better products. Whatever your identity, we give your application fair consideration.

],

  • Australia Canonical Full time

    Software Platform Engineering Manager - Ubuntu for Next-Gen Silicon Canonical Canberra, Australian Capital Territory, Australia2 months ago Be among the first 25 applicantsGet AI-powered advice on this job and more exclusive features.Canonical is a leading provider of open source software and operating systems to the global enterprise and technology...


  • Australia Canonical Full time

    Senior Software Engineer - Digital Workplace Canonical Canberra, Australian Capital Territory, AustraliaJoin or sign in to find your next job Join to apply for the Senior Software Engineer - Digital Workplace role at CanonicalSenior Software Engineer - Digital Workplace Canonical Canberra, Australian Capital Territory, Australia3 days ago Be among the first...


  • Australia Epam Systems Full time

    Senior Software Engineer (PHP)– EPAM SystemsOverviewWe're hiring aSenior Software Engineer (PHP)to join the team for a list of projects to incrementally add feature enhancements to our promotion system. You\'ll make an impact at every level of society by empowering innovators, creative thinkers, entrepreneurs, and business owners around the world to be...


  • Australia Buscojobs Full time

    OverviewSenior Software Engineer Ts Golang jobs in SydneySoftware Engineer (Android)2060 Waverton, New South Wales Advertising Industry CareersPosted todayJob DescriptionCompany DescriptionNine is Australia's largest locally owned media company. Working at Nine, you'll have access to a unique range of experiences and opportunities, helping drive the success...


  • Australia Canonical Full time

    Embedded Linux Senior Software Engineer - Optimisation Canonical Canberra, Australian Capital Territory, AustraliaJoin or sign in to find your next job Join to apply for the Embedded Linux Senior Software Engineer - Optimisation role at CanonicalEmbedded Linux Senior Software Engineer - Optimisation Canonical Canberra, Australian Capital Territory,...


  • Australia Microsoft Corporation Full time

    OverviewThe Azure Core New Tech team is seeking a Senior Software Engineer who is eager to help with the New Technology onboarding process: automating how new hardware is verified, managed, and delivered to Microsoft datacenters for Azure, High-Performance Computing, Office, and Edge Computing products within Microsoft.The team works at the interface of...


  • Australia Skutopia Full time

    OverviewSKUTOPIA is on a mission to democratise and decarbonise logistics. We are a deep-tech logistics company operating under a dual RaaS (Robotics-as-a-Service) and SaaS model. We deliver end-to-end, AI-powered robotic fulfilment for retailers - eliminating inefficiencies inherent in traditional 3PL models, such as human error, high labour costs, and...


  • Australia Microsoft Full time

    OverviewThe Azure Networking team continues to innovate across the stack, pushing new scale and features into the cloud and desktop platforms while transforming our infrastructure to meet the growing needs of the Artificial Intelligence infrastructure and several hundred thousand customers using Azure Services to host and run their Cloud Services in over 100...


  • Australia beBeeInnovator Full time $160,000 - $200,000

    Android Software Engineer: Prime ProgramAs a Senior Android Software Engineer, you will be part of our development team in Australia. Your mission is to scale our membership program to best-in-class quality that customers truly love.We're seeking an experienced Android Software Engineer to work with a top-notch tech stack including Kotlin, Java, Espresso,...


  • Australia Pedestrian Group Full time

    Nine is Australia's largest locally owned media company – the home of Australia's most trusted and loved brands spanning News, Sport, Lifestyle, and Entertainment. We pride ourselves on creating the best content, accessed by consumers when and how they want – across Publishing, Broadcasting and Digital.Nine's assets include the 9Network, major mastheads...